The Q12RP6RQ3 by Banner is a receiver-mode photoelectric sensor built for opposed-mode sensing applications, where it operates in tandem with a separate emitter. It offers a maximum sensing distance of 2000 mm, making it suitable for applications requiring precise, long-range detection across conveyors, gates, or material handling lines. The sensor uses a visible red LED beam with a 640 nm wavelength to detect the interruption of light caused by a passing object. It is housed in a compact rectangular thermoplastic body with a polycarbonate lens, ensuring durability and resistance to dust, moisture, and vibration.
Rated IP67, the sensor is dust-tight and protected against temporary water immersion, making it highly reliable in harsh industrial settings. It runs on a 10–30 V DC power supply and delivers PNP output via a standard 3-pin M8 connector. The sensor features a quick 1.3 ms ON and 0.9 ms OFF response time, along with 175 µs repeatability for stable performance in high-speed automation lines. A 120 ms startup delay ensures clean system initialization. LED indicators provide clear status feedback, reducing downtime during diagnostics. Applications of Q12RP6RQ3: 74193 - Banner
The Q12RP6RQ3 is widely used in opposed-mode detection systems in packaging lines, logistics conveyors, automated entry gates, and robotic assembly processes. Its long sensing range and fast response make it ideal for detecting pallets, trays, cartons, or fast-moving machine parts. Its M8 quick-connect interface makes replacement and setup fast, especially in high-maintenance or time-sensitive environments.
